Output e96df6bc79395d5149d061bccfb0c32c01eaea800904b9ae43daa169329078ea:1

value
50951921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cfa98a7abf92c33c9673c3eb1e988a333bb9baf OP_EQUALVERIFY OP_CHECKSIG
address
156pwBHSBNN3ovDouTyHj7LPMef2MXjLD2
transaction
e96df6bc79395d5149d061bccfb0c32c01eaea800904b9ae43daa169329078ea
spent
true